This award-winning and controversial film chronicles the life of Yigal Amir the year proceeding his assassination of Prime Minister Yitzhak Rabin. After years of research, the writers of Incitement create a gripping depiction of the forces in the world that can twist a life to its breaking point, all accompanied by a harrowing score. Deftly weaving real historical footage, director Yaron Zilberman brings us a tense and thrilling depiction of the events that can lead a man to believe that murder is morally, religiously, and politically justifiable.

Guest Speaker:
Yehuda Halevi Nahari, Lead Actor
Yehuda Nahari Halevi is an Israeli actor, known for Incitement (2019), Tyrant (2014) and Snails in the Rain (2013).
